Quest chain that gives you a free teleport spell to Maj'dul.

I'm just wondering if it overrides Call to Qeynos or if I complete chain will I have both Call of Qeynos and Call of Maj'dul?

It should be an entirely new spell. And as a bonus, if you did the "Tie That Binds" quest, that should let you reset the new bind point to anywhere in Maj`Dul. (I don't think the reset spell is specific to any one recall spell since "Tie That Binds" can be done by Qeynosians or Freeportians.)

Yes, it's a new spell, and a good way to get out of a tight situation if your waiting for CoQ to refresh. CoR takes you to the carpet at the entrance of Maj Dul (safe area), and a quick ride to Sinking Sands if you choose.

There is also a quest line to get access to Shimmering Citadel. You get a mirror that teleports you there, and right in front of a SS teleporter.

After completing many of these quests, one can have many options of travel across the continents.

The orcs are part of the Tears faction that take over the city when either a Blades or Coin Captain has been killed at the top of one of their towers.

So it isn't always like this but certainly interesting the first time you run into them.

There's also a series of quests that give you a port to Splitpaw which some people use to avoid the 60s Harbourmaster's fee.
